How to change your Microsoft account password | Xbox Support
Once you've made the change, you'll receive a notification at your existing account email address or phone number. This is a precaution in case someone else made the change. If that happens, you can cancel the change by following the instructions in the notification.
Dark Mode in Outlook - Microsoft Support
Select the sun icon to change the message window background to white. Select the moon icon to change the message window background to black. When composing a message, you can turn dark mode on or off from the Message toolbar by selecting the dark mode icon to change the message window to white or black.
